Common Conditions Treated at a Stem Cell Clinic

Stem cell therapy is likely one of the most talked-about areas in modern medicine, but many patients still wonder what conditions are actually treated at a stem cell clinic. The reply depends on the type of clinic, the kind of stem cells getting used, and whether the treatment is an established normal of care or still being studied in clinical trials. Today, probably the most established and widely accepted stem cell treatments contain blood-forming stem cells, also called hematopoietic stem cells, which are utilized in bone marrow or stem cell transplants. These therapies are primarily used for serious blood cancers, bone marrow problems, immune deficiencies, and certain inherited metabolic diseases.

One of the crucial widespread groups of conditions treated with stem cell transplantation is blood cancer. This includes leukemia, lymphoma, and multiple myeloma. In these cases, stem cells are used to help rebuild the patient’s bone marrow after high-dose chemotherapy or radiation. The goal is not simply to “repair” tissue, but to restore the body’s ability to make healthy blood cells and, in some cases, permit docs to present more aggressive cancer treatment than would otherwise be possible. For many patients, a stem cell transplant is usually a major part of treatment and even provide an opportunity for long-term remission.

Stem cell clinics linked to major hospitals additionally commonly treat noncancerous blood disorders. These include aplastic anemia, where the bone marrow stops producing sufficient blood cells, and sure bone marrow failure syndromes. In these situations, stem cell therapy could also be used to replace unhealthy or damaged blood-forming cells with healthy ones from the patient or a donor. Some transplant centers also use stem cell procedures for myelodysplastic syndromes and related marrow problems when other therapies aren’t enough.

One other essential class is immune system disease. Some stem cell transplant programs treat severe immunodeficiencies, particularly in children and younger patients with inherited conditions that weaken the immune system. In sure cases, replacing the faulty blood-forming stem cells will help rebuild immune function. This is one reason stem cell clinics at academic medical centers often work intently with hematologists, oncologists, and immunology specialists rather than working as standalone wellness centers.

Sure inherited metabolic problems might also be treated with stem cell transplantation. These are rare genetic conditions in which the body can’t properly break down sure substances, leading to progressive damage over time. For selected patients, particularly when recognized early, stem cell transplant might help slow illness progression by introducing healthy donor-derived cells. This is a highly specialised area, but it remains one of many recognized medical makes use of of stem cell therapy in major transplant programs.

Some advanced centers additionally use hematopoietic stem cell transplantation for chosen autoimmune illnesses in carefully chosen patients. Severe systemic sclerosis, also called scleroderma, is likely one of the best-known examples studied by the NIH and transplant specialists. In these cases, the aim is to reset the immune system after intensive treatment. However, this isn’t routine care for each autoimmune condition, and it is often reserved for extreme disease under specialist supervision.

It is usually important to understand what is still considered experimental. Many private clinics advertise stem cell treatment for arthritis, sports injuries, back pain, Parkinson’s illness, Alzheimer’s disease, heart failure, and diabetes. While researchers are actively studying stem cells for these problems, they don’t seem to be broadly established within the same way as blood and marrow transplants. Patients ought to be cautious about clinics that promise dramatic results for a wide range of unrelated conditions, especially when they do not clearly clarify regulatory status, risks, or supporting evidence. The FDA maintains a list of approved mobile and gene therapy products, and that list is far narrower than many marketing claims suggest.

So, what conditions are commonly treated at a legitimate stem cell clinic? In mainstream medicine, the commonest solutions are leukemia, lymphoma, multiple myeloma, aplastic anemia, bone marrow issues, immune deficiencies, and a few inherited metabolic diseases. In choose cases, sure autoimmune ailments may additionally be treated at specialised centers. One of the best stem cell clinics concentrate on evidence-primarily based care, careful patient screening, and realistic expectations. In case you are considering treatment, look for a clinic affiliated with a recognized hospital or transplant center, and always ask whether the therapy is FDA-approved, commonplace follow, or part of a clinical trial.
